The Tin Plated Metal Can Market is primarily driven by the widespread use of tin-plated cans in packaging applications. These cans are highly durable, corrosion-resistant, and provide an effective barrier against moisture, light, and oxygen, which are essential for preserving the quality and shelf life of various products. The market is segmented based on different applications, with significant demand from the food and beverage industry, including sub-segments such as fruits and vegetables, meat and seafood, pet food, soups, and other food categories. This segmentation highlights the versatility of tin-plated metal cans in preserving and enhancing the shelf life of both perishable and non-perishable products. Fruits and Vegetables

The fruits and vegetables segment holds a prominent position in the Tin Plated Metal Can Market due to the growing demand for canned produce as an alternative to fresh items. Canning preserves the nutritional content, taste, and texture of fruits and vegetables, making them a convenient option for consumers, especially in regions where fresh produce may not be readily available year-round. Tin-plated cans offer protection from light and air, both of which can degrade the quality of fruits and vegetables over time. The ability of these cans to provide a secure seal ensures the preservation of flavor and nutrients while extending the shelf life of the contents. Meat and Seafood

The meat and seafood segment within the Tin Plated Metal Can Market benefits from the need for long shelf life and the desire for convenience among consumers. Canned meat and seafood products, such as tuna, salmon, chicken, and beef, offer a practical solution for both emergency food supplies and everyday meal preparation. The cans protect these protein-rich products from external elements such as oxygen and moisture, maintaining their quality and nutritional content. As the demand for convenient, high-protein foods continues to rise, especially in developed countries where busy lifestyles are common, canned meat and seafood offer an easy-to-store, long-lasting option. Additionally, these products have gained traction in regions with limited access to fresh meat and seafood due to refrigeration limitations, making canned alternatives a valuable commodity in such markets.

Pet Food

The pet food segment is another critical application of tin-plated metal cans, driven by the growing pet population globally and the increasing demand for high-quality, convenient pet food options. Pet food manufacturers often use tin-plated cans to package wet food, which provides several advantages, including long shelf life, protection from contaminants, and preservation of flavor and nutritional value. The need for pet owners to provide their pets with nutritious, safe, and easily accessible food has led to an increase in the popularity of canned pet food. Canned pet food is particularly favored for its practicality, ease of use, and ability to cater to the dietary needs of various pets, including dogs and cats. Soups

The soups segment within the Tin Plated Metal Can Market is a key contributor to the overall demand for canned food products. Tin-plated cans are widely used in packaging both ready-to-serve soups and concentrated soup products, as these packaging solutions help preserve the freshness, taste, and nutritional value of the soup while providing a long shelf life. The convenience of having soups available in cans for quick meals makes them a popular choice among busy consumers, especially in developed markets. The preservation capabilities of tin-plated cans ensure that the soups are protected from spoilage caused by oxygen, light, or moisture, while retaining their rich flavors and textures.
